82 (defcustom gnus-check-new-newsgroups 'ask-server
83 "*Non-nil means that Gnus will run `gnus-find-new-newsgroups' at startup.
84 This normally finds new newsgroups by comparing the active groups the
85 servers have already reported with those Gnus already knows, either alive
86 or killed.
88 When any of the following are true, `gnus-find-new-newsgroups' will instead
89 ask the servers (primary, secondary, and archive servers) to list new
90 groups since the last time it checked:
91 1. This variable is `ask-server'.
92 2. This variable is a list of select methods (see below).
93 3. `gnus-read-active-file' is nil or `some'.
94 4. A prefix argument is given to `gnus-find-new-newsgroups' interactively.
96 Thus, if this variable is `ask-server' or a list of select methods or
97 `gnus-read-active-file' is nil or `some', then the killed list is no
98 longer necessary, so you could safely set `gnus-save-killed-list' to nil.
100 This variable can be a list of select methods which Gnus will query with
101 the `ask-server' method in addition to the primary, secondary, and archive
102 servers.
105 (setq gnus-check-new-newsgroups
106 '((nntp \"some.server\") (nntp \"other.server\")))
108 If this variable is nil, then you have to tell Gnus explicitly to
109 check for new newsgroups with \\<gnus-group-mode-map>\\[gnus-find-new-newsgroups]."
110 :group 'gnus-start
111 :type '(choice (const :tag "no" nil)
112 (const :tag "by brute force" t)
113 (const :tag "ask servers" ask-server)
114 (repeat :menu-tag "ask additional servers"
115 :tag "ask additional servers"
116 :value ((nntp ""))
117 (sexp :format "%v"))))

126 (defcustom gnus-read-active-file 'some
127 "*Non-nil means that Gnus will read the entire active file at startup.
128 If this variable is nil, Gnus will only know about the groups in your
129 `.newsrc' file.
131 If this variable is `some', Gnus will try to only read the relevant
132 parts of the active file from the server. Not all servers support
133 this, and it might be quite slow with other servers, but this should
134 generally be faster than both the t and nil value.
136 If you set this variable to nil or `some', you probably still want to
137 be told about new newsgroups that arrive. To do that, set
138 `gnus-check-new-newsgroups' to `ask-server'. This may not work
139 properly with all servers."
140 :group 'gnus-start-server
141 :type '(choice (const nil)
142 (const some)
143 (const t)))

1156 ;; `gnus-group-change-level' is the fundamental function for changing
1157 ;; subscription levels of newsgroups. This might mean just changing
1158 ;; from level 1 to 2, which is pretty trivial, from 2 to 6 or back
1159 ;; again, which subscribes/unsubscribes a group, which is equally
1160 ;; trivial. Changing from 1-7 to 8-9 means that you kill a group, and
1161 ;; from 8-9 to 1-7 means that you remove the group from the list of
1162 ;; killed (or zombie) groups and add them to the (kinda) subscribed
1163 ;; groups. And last but not least, moving from 8 to 9 and 9 to 8,
1164 ;; which is trivial.
1165 ;; ENTRY can either be a string (newsgroup name) or a list (if
1166 ;; FROMKILLED is t, it's a list on the format (NUM INFO-LIST),
1167 ;; otherwise it's a list in the format of the `gnus-newsrc-hashtb'
1168 ;; entries.
1169 ;; LEVEL is the new level of the group, OLDLEVEL is the old level and
1170 ;; PREVIOUS is the group (in hashtb entry format) to insert this group
1171 ;; after.

2188 ;; Parse options lines to find "options -n !all rec.all" and stuff.
2189 ;; The return value will be a list on the form
2190 ;; ((regexp1 . ignore)
2191 ;; (regexp2 . subscribe)...)
2192 ;; When handling new newsgroups, groups that match a `ignore' regexp
2193 ;; will be ignored, and groups that match a `subscribe' regexp will be
2194 ;; subscribed. A line like
2195 ;; options -n !all rec.all
2196 ;; will lead to a list that looks like
2197 ;; (("^rec\\..+" . subscribe)
2198 ;; ("^.+" . ignore))
2199 ;; So all "rec.*" groups will be subscribed, while all the other
2200 ;; groups will be ignored. Note that "options -n !all rec.all" is very
2201 ;; different from "options -n rec.all !all".
